New Delhi: Most of the north Indian states are reeling under a severe heatwave. The first week of April is going on and the scorching sun and heat have made it difficult for people to live. According to the India Meteorological Department (IMD), there is no possibility of any heat relief for the next five days in northwest and central India. The Met department has predicted heatwave or hot winds in these states. 

According to the Met department, heatwave conditions are expected over Rajasthan, Uttar Pradesh, South Punjab, South Haryana-Delhi, Madhya Pradesh, Bihar and Jharkhand during the next five days. With this, the northern parts of Gujarat will see the havoc of a heatwave for the next 3 days. At the same time, heatwave conditions are likely to prevail in Himachal Pradesh, Vidarbha, parts of Bihar and parts of the Jammu region and Chhattisgarh.     

During the coming 24 hours, Himachal Pradesh, Assam, Sikkim and sub-Himalayan West Bengal may receive heavy rainfall at some places with light to moderate rainfall, according to the MET department's forecast. Along with this, light to moderate rain may occur at isolated places in Kerala and Andaman and the Nicobar Islands. Tamil Nadu, Karnataka and south-central Maharashtra will receive light rain.
